OpenAI’s Sora model is a leap forward for video-generation technology. How does it work, and what will it mean?

Late last week, OpenAI announced a new generative AI system named Sora, which produces short videos from text prompts. While Sora is not yet available to the public, the high quality of the sample outputs published so far has provoked both excited and concerned reactions.

How does Sora work? Sora combines features of text and image generating tools in what is called a “diffusion transformer model”. Sora uses the transformer architecture to handle how frames relate to one another. While transformers were initially designed to find patterns in tokens representing text, Sora instead uses tokens representing small patches of space and time.
